Danish Refugee Council (DRC) About
The Danish Refugee Council (DRC) is a humanitarian, non-governmental, non-profit organisation founded in 1956 that works in more than 30 countries throughout the world. DRC fulfils its mandate by providing direct assistance to conflict-affected populations – refugees, internally displaced people and host communities in the conflict areas of the world; and by advocating on behalf of conflict-affected populations internationally, and in Denmark, on the basis of humanitarian principles and the Human Rights Declaration.

The Danish Refugee Council (DRC) is one of the world’s leading humanitarian NGOs, established in 195
  • DRC has been operational in Georgia since 1999, with a significant presence in the region, including an operation in Abkhazia since 200
  • The organization focuses on addressing vulnerabilities and engaging in poverty reduction, particularly for displaced and conflict-affected persons. DRC operates across various sectors, including livelihoods, access to social services, governance, education, and shelter/housing, with a commitment to sustainable community development. The organization currently employs over 28 staff members across four offices in Georgia, including two field offices in Abkhazia, and works with major donors such as SIDA, the Norwegian Ministry of Foreign Affairs, and the European Union.
